Thorgan Hazard wants Atletico Madrid move

Borussia Monchengladbach midfielder Thorgan Hazard wants a summer move to Atletico Madrid, according to a report in Sport Bild.

The Belgian international, brother of Chelsea playmaker Eden, is out of contract at the Bundesliga club in the summer of 2020 and they could cash in this summer.

The 25-year-old is said to be valued at €40m by the German outfit but Thierry Hazard, the father and agent of Thorgan, is said to be confident a €25m move could be brokered.

The report claims that the idea is for Thorgan and Eden to be lining up on rival sides of the Madrid derby next season, with Eden strongly linked with a move to Real Madrid.

Hazard has previously been linked to Sevilla and Valencia but he has now emerged as a prime transfer target for Los Rojiblancos.

Gladbach could miss out on qualification for this season’s Champions League and has nine league goals to his name this campaign.
